Guardian Power FDM16 sp drill press binds when trying to lower bit.

by first engaging the quill lock (or blocking the quill in place), then removing the nut over the center of the spring housing opposite the quill handle, but be very careful; The spring is under a lot of tension, and if broken or jarred, it can fly out of the housing, causing serious injury. I'd strongly suggest you find a service manual for it before attempting any repairs or adjustment. The fact that the quill is binding leads me to believe that the spring is set improperly, which might be remedied by carefully (slightly) loosening the nut, thus allowing you to rotate the housing, allowing a small amount of tension at a time to be removed from the spring, until desired operation is achieved. In any case, no attempt should be made to remove the housing until the spring tension is safely relieved. The procedure is very similar to that for a bridgeport mill, so that manual for quill (clock) spring adjustment/replacement might be of use to you also.

The sanding belt keeps coming off. The tracking adjustment isn’t functioning.

This belt should be mounted so that the overlap trails when the belt sander is used, sometimes these belts will have arrows indicating the direction of rotation but not always. The arrows usually disappear after a bit of use anyway so if you change grits or re-use belts it is good to know which way to run the belt by looking at the join. Here another fix that has worked for me. Take some ordinary electricians tape and make several laps around the idler pulley on the belt sander. Put more thicknesses near the center of the idler, than the outside. This effectively builds a small crown on the pulley and makes the belt stay centered. Also, always relieve the tension on the belt when not using the sander. The belt can stretch and tracks poorly if this happens.

I have a Goulds J10s, the pump housing gets very hot. seems to be working but it's incredibly hot

Check incoming voltage umder load. if its under nameplate volts when running you have overcurrent. check fan inside housing for damage or blockage. finally check disch pressure to make sure no restriction blockage in line. Im Pentair engineering person
